Select the desired Examination under the Available Courses/Materials heading. Add your exam to your Cart to check out. Once you add the exam to your Cart, click the Check Out tab to complete the registration process. At the Check Out page, you can: 1. Log in as a RETURNING USER if you have already created your online learning account and are adding another course.

Click the Create New User Account button and fill out the requested information to complete your registration. Use a valid email address for your login to receive your purchase receipt, login confirmation and instructions. Follow the link provided at the finish of your successful registration/check out. If you have provided a valid email address, you will be sent a confirmation email. You can return to the site at any time and follow the link in the yellow box to your course. Please Note: New Applicants: If you are a new applicant for licensure, print your certificate and submit it to the board office with your application. Retain a copy for your records.
